The Perfect Compact Greenhouse for Any Garden
Not every garden has room for a large greenhouse — but every garden deserves one. The Palmako Emilia S was designed with exactly this in mind. Its square footprint tucks neatly into a corner, against a fence, or alongside a path. Yet step inside and the 286cm overall height creates a surprisingly generous, light-filled interior. Full-height toughened glass panels on all sides flood the space with natural light, creating ideal growing conditions for seedlings, herbs, tomatoes, and tender plants. And when the growing season is over, the Emilia S transitions effortlessly into a glass summer house — a quiet retreat at the bottom of the garden.

Product Specifications
| External Dimensions | 2.4m x 2.4m |
| Floor Area | 5.4 m² |
| Overall Height | 286.0 cm |
| Wall Height | 159.0 cm |
| Construction Type | Post and beam |
| Wall Thickness | 18mm pressure treated timber |
| Roof Type | Apex roof, 45.0° |
| Roof Area | 8.4 m² |
| Glass Type | Toughened safety glass, 4mm |
| Single Door | 1 — 69cm x 183cm |
| Foundation (included) | Prepared and installed as part of the price |
| Composite DPC Strip (included) | Fitted beneath all pressure-treated timber at foundation level |
| Ground Membrane (included) | Laid beneath the building as standard |
| Anti-Insect & Rodent Mesh (included) | Installed as standard on every build |
| Timber Treatment (included) | Smart Seal — 10 years protection |
| Suitable Use | Compact greenhouse, glass summer house, glass house, garden pavilion |

Do I need planning permission for the Palmako Emilia S?
In most cases, no. At 2.4m x 2.4m and 286cm overall height, the Emilia S will fall within Permitted Development rights for most residential properties in England and Wales, provided it is used as an ancillary garden building, is sited within the curtilage of a dwelling house, is not forward of the principal elevation, and does not cover more than 50% of the garden area. Is the glass safe?
Yes. The Emilia S uses toughened 4mm safety glass throughout — the same specification used in domestic glazing. It is significantly stronger than standard horticultural glass and, if broken, shatters into small, blunt fragments rather than sharp shards.
